Responsibilities
  • Assists in preparation of financial statement footnote disclosures required for Client and subsidiaries 10-K and 10-Q
  • Liaise with regional coordinators relating to Client's international pension and postretirement plans to review, follow-up and consolidate information for 10-K and 10-Q
  • Assists in preparation and filing of financial statements and footnote disclosures required for U.S. employee benefit plans
  • Support internal and external audits for US employee pension plans
  • Coordinate tax preparation required for US employee benefit plans with internal and external teams
  • Work with internal teams and external vendors to strengthen process controls and financial reporting
  • Prepare financial reporting for all non-qualified pension plans and medical plans
  • Support inquiries from Corporate groups (Finance, Tax, Legal and Benefits)
  • Prepare monthly journal entries and manage monthly and quarterly closing process
  • Prepare balance sheet reconciliations and roll forwards for employee benefit plans
